Joe Flacco Shatters Own Ravens Record For Consecutive Completions

Flacco broke his own Ravens record for consecutive completions with 21 against Jacksonville. The number paused at 17 when the teams went back to their locker rooms for halftime with Baltimore leading, 13-7. The streak ended when Flacco attempted a deep pass to Mike Wallace in the end zone early in the third quarter. MORE: Live Ravens-Jaguars updates Flacco’s previous record was 14 straight completions, accomplished in 2009 against the Broncos....
